Why Fees Matter in Crypto Trading
Before diving into the exchanges themselves, it's important to understand why trading fees are substantial. Trading fees generally include:
Maker Fees: Charged when you provide liquidity to the marketplace by putting a limit order that isn't right away matched.Taker Fees: Charged when you take liquidity from the market by putting an order that is instantly matched with an existing order.Deposit Fees: Charges sustained while funding your account.Withdrawal Fees: Fees for withdrawing your possessions from the exchange.
High trading and deal fees can lessen your prospective earnings, particularly for those who trade often or in little margins. Therefore, deciding for an exchange with lower fees is sensible.

Binance
Binance is one of the biggest Crypto Exchanges With Lowest Fees exchanges globally, providing a large variety of cryptocurrencies for trading.
Fees: Binance charges a basic fee of 0.1% for both makers and takers, which can be minimized to 0.075% if you pay utilizing their native token, BNB. Additionally, lots of deposit alternatives are free.2. Kraken
Kraken is widely known for its strong security features and wide selection of tokens.
Fees: The fee structure is tiered based upon trading volume, with maker fees varying from 0% to 0.16% and taker fees from 0.10% to 0.26%. Kraken generally does not charge deposit fees and has a competitive withdrawal fee structure.3. Coinbase Pro
Coinbase Pro targets advanced users trying to find additional functions while offering a basic transition course from Coinbase.
Fees: The platform uses a tiered fee structure that permits fees to drop as trading volume increases, causing prospective fees as low as 0.05%. There are no fees for deposits, making it rather appealing.4. Bitfinex
Bitfinex is a trading center for expert traders with functions customized to their needs.
Fees: Bitfinex charges a 0.1% maker fee and a 0.2% taker fee. Its fee structure supports customized trading conditions and allows for fee modifications based on the quantity of trading.5. Huobi
Huobi is another substantial global crypto exchange with a variety of digital currencies.
Fees: The standard trading fees are set at 0.2% for both makers and takers, which is competitive, and the platform regularly runs promotions that might reduce fees even more.6. KuCoin
KuCoin is likewise known for its broad variety of coins and easy to use interface.
Fees: KuCoin uses a competitive 0.1% trading fee across the board and permits its users to utilize KCS token to decrease fees even further.7. OKEx
OKEx is recognized for its futures trading products.
